I visited Mr Wang Hot Pot which is specialised in Malatang, a common type of Chinese street food. Malatang is named after the key ingredient, mala sauce, the word mala referring to the sensation of spicy numbness in the mouth after eating the sauce. The sauce is primarily flavoured with Sichuan peppercorns, douban paste, and chilli peppers.

Great food. For anyone who has not had Chinese Malatang(Similar to Chinese hot pot but you only order for yourself which is served in a small pot), you might need some guidance from the staff on how to order.
